Gauge32Value::Gauge32Value ( binary::const_iterator &  pos,
const binary::const_iterator &  end,
bool  big_endian = true 
)

Parse Constructor.

This constructor parses the serialized form of the object. It takes an iterator, starts parsing at the position of the iterator and advances the iterator to the position right behind the object.

The constructor expects valid data from the stream; if parsing fails, parse_error is thrown. In this case, the iterator position is undefined.

Parameters
posIterator pointing to the current stream position. The iterator is advanced while reading the header.
endIterator pointing one element past the end of the current stream. This is needed to mark the end of the buffer.
big_endianWhether the input stream is in big endian format

binary Gauge32Value::serialize ( ) const
virtual

Encode the object as described in RFC 2741, section 5.4.

This function uses big endian.

uint32_t agentxcpp::Gauge32Value::value

The value.

According to RFC 2578, Gauge32 is a non-negative 32-bit number.
